Pediatric dysrhythmias.

Stephanie J Doniger1, Ghazala Q Sharieff

  • 1Pediatric Emergency Medicine, Children's Hospital and Health Center/University of California-San Diego, 3020 Children's Way, MC 5075 San Diego, CA 92123-4282, USA. sdoniger@sbcglobal.net

Pediatric Clinics of North America
|February 21, 2006
PubMed
Summary

Pediatric arrhythmias, including supraventricular tachycardia and bradycardia, are increasing due to congenital heart disease repairs. Prompt identification and treatment are vital to prevent decompensation in children.

Area of Science:

  • Pediatric Cardiology
  • Cardiac Electrophysiology

Background:

  • Pediatric arrhythmias are increasing, particularly in children with repaired congenital heart disease.
  • Supraventricular tachycardia is the most common symptomatic tachyarrhythmia in children.
  • Atrial flutter and fibrillation in children often indicate underlying structural heart disease.

Purpose of the Study:

  • To summarize the current understanding of pediatric arrhythmias.
  • To highlight the importance of timely diagnosis and management of pediatric rhythm abnormalities.

Main Methods:

  • Literature review of pediatric arrhythmias.
  • Analysis of common pediatric tachyarrhythmias and bradycardias.
  • Discussion of etiological factors and clinical significance.

Main Results:

  • Sinus bradycardia is the most frequent cause of bradycardia in pediatric patients.
  • Congenital heart disease is a significant factor in pediatric atrial flutter and fibrillation.
  • Early detection of arrhythmias is critical for preventing further cardiac decompensation.

Conclusions:

  • Pediatric arrhythmias require prompt recognition and management.
  • Increased survival from congenital heart disease contributes to a rise in pediatric arrhythmias.
  • Effective treatment of arrhythmias is essential for improving outcomes in pediatric cardiac patients.
